Universidad Nacional Experimental Simón Rodríguez
Núcleo Zaraza - Venezuela
Unidad 1

Algoritmos

Es un conjunto de instrucciones para resolver un problema, realizar un cálculo o desarrollar una tarea. Es decir, un algoritmo es un procedimiento, paso a paso, para conseguir un fin. A partir de un estado e información iniciales, se siguen una serie de pasos ordenados para llegar a la solución de una situación. Se trata de una serie de acciones elementales, ordenadas y secuenciadas para guiar un proceso determinado. En las Ciencias de la Computación, los algoritmos constituyen el esqueleto de los procesos que luego se codificarán y programarán para que sean realizados por el computador.


Partes de un Algoritmo

  • Input (entrada): Información que se da al algoritmo con la que va a trabajar para ofrecer la solución esperada.
  • Proceso: Conjunto de pasos para que, a partir de los datos de entrada, llegue a la solución de la situación.
  • Output (salida):Resultados, a partir de la transformación de los valores de entrada durante el proceso.

Características de los algoritmos

  • Precisos: Objetivos, sin ambigüedad.
  • Ordenados: Presentan una secuencia clara y precisa para poder llegar a la solución.
  • Finitos: Contienen un número determinado de pasos.
  • Concretos: Ofrecen una solución determinada para la situación o problema planteados.
  • Definidos: El mismo algoritmo debe dar el mismo resultado al recibir la misma entrada.

Ejemplo de un Algoritmo

La tarea de hacer té.

En este caso, el algoritmo sería el conjunto de instrucciones que se seguirían para hacer el té. Así que, el algoritmo incluiría los siguientes pasos:

  • Calentar agua en una holla.
  • Añadir a la misma (incluso mientras el agua se calienta) jengibre.
  • Añadir las hojas de té.
  • Añadir la leche.
  • Cuando comienza a hervir, añadir el azúcar.
  • Dejar cocer, a fuego lento, durante 2 o 3 minutos.
  • Siguiendo las instrucciones anteriores, se obtendría el resultado deseado y se resolvería el problema o se cumpliría la tarea.


Para una mejor comprensión del tema Algoritmo, les ofrezco el siguiente video:

AnteriorSiguiente
Universidad Nacional Experimental Simón Rodríguez - Núcleo Zaraza, Venezuela - Prof. Luis J. Martínez J. - 2023
Free Web Hosting